The repayment schedule includes many choices for payment including changes in standard payment, it could be fixed r fixed other a set amount of time.
The payments could be what is called graduated which means that over time, the monthly payments could increase to reflect current interest rates and to make the loan become paid in full sooner. If your total student loan is over thirty thousand dollars, you may be able to extend the number of years in which the loan will become due. The repayment period for loan balances of thirty thousand to forty thousand dollars is twenty years maximum. Loan Balances of forty to sixty thousand dollars is twenty five years. And loans sixty thousand and more have a repayment period of thirty years. As you can see, the consolidation programs offer a wide range of opportunities to complete repayment of your student loans.
